What Are the Key Safety Features in Toy Drones for Kids?
The key safety features in toy drones for kids include:
- Propeller Guards: These are protective rings around the propellers that prevent injuries to children and damage to the drone in case of collisions.
- Altitude Hold: This feature helps the drone maintain a steady height, making it easier for kids to control and reducing the risk of crashes.
- Emergency Stop Function: This allows the drone to immediately halt its operation with a single button press, preventing accidents or injuries during unexpected situations.
- Lightweight Design: A lightweight construction minimizes the potential for injury and reduces damage to the drone itself in case of falls.
- Stable Flight Modes: These modes help keep the drone steady in the air, making it less likely to tip over or crash, which is particularly beneficial for novice pilots.
- Durable Materials: The use of flexible and impact-resistant materials in toy drones ensures they can withstand rough handling and minor accidents, making them safer for kids.
Propeller guards are essential components that shield rotating blades, which can cause cuts or injuries. By encasing the propellers, these guards also help prevent damage to the drone during mishaps.
Altitude hold is a crucial feature that allows the drone to maintain a constant height, which simplifies flying for children and minimizes the likelihood of crashing, especially in crowded or indoor environments.
The emergency stop function provides an immediate way to stop the drone’s flight, which can be vital in situations where the drone behaves unexpectedly or heads towards a dangerous area.
A lightweight design is important as it reduces the risk of injury if the drone falls onto someone, while also making it easier for kids to maneuver the aircraft without excessive strain.
Stable flight modes are designed to enhance the flying experience by ensuring that the drone remains level, enabling young pilots to gain confidence and skill without frequent crashes.
Lastly, the use of durable materials in the construction of toy drones ensures they can withstand the rough handling typical of children’s play, thus enhancing safety and longevity.

How Can Kids Safely Use Toy Drones?
To ensure kids can safely use toy drones, several essential guidelines and features should be considered:
- Age Appropriateness: Choose drones that are designed specifically for the age group of the child.
- Durable Design: Opt for drones made from sturdy materials that can withstand crashes and rough handling.
- Easy Controls: Look for drones with intuitive controls that are easy for kids to learn and operate.
- Safety Features: Select drones equipped with safety features such as propeller guards and automatic landing.
- Flight Restrictions: Educate kids about local regulations and restricted areas for flying drones.
- Supervision: Encourage adult supervision during flight times to ensure safe operation and adherence to guidelines.
Choosing age-appropriate drones ensures that the device matches the child’s maturity and skill level, reducing the risk of accidents or injuries. Manufacturers often label drones with recommended age ranges, helping parents make informed decisions.
A durable design is crucial since kids may not always handle devices gently. Drones constructed from impact-resistant materials can endure falls and rough play, prolonging their lifespan and ensuring a safer experience for young users.
Easy controls are essential for kids who are just beginning to learn how to fly. Drones with user-friendly remote controls, often featuring one-button takeoff and landing, can help children gain confidence without feeling overwhelmed.
Safety features, such as propeller guards, are vital in preventing injuries during operation. Automatic landing capabilities also provide peace of mind, as they can help avoid crashes in case of low battery or loss of control.
Educating children about flight restrictions is necessary to promote responsible drone usage. Teaching them about no-fly zones, such as near airports or crowded spaces, helps instill a sense of responsibility and awareness of their surroundings.
Finally, maintaining adult supervision during drone flights can significantly enhance safety. Adults can assist with pre-flight checks, guide children during flight, and intervene if any issues arise, ensuring a safer and more enjoyable experience for everyone involved.
